I learned that lightening is coming in both directions. Small feeders grow upwards and attract the large charges that are desending. When they find each other WHHOOMP.

Lightening still is a surprisingly unkown quantity in its exact mechanics. Its only been a decade since we learned conclusively that lightening "sprites" shoot upwards into the ionosphere and disperse in a widening cone. This was folklore by airline pilots until satillites captured some pictures.
